How much do bilingual human resources professional jobs pay per year?

As of May 28, 2026, the average yearly pay for bilingual human resources professional in Brooklyn, NY is $63,185.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$52,600.00 and $73,600.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Bilingual Human Resources Professional,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Bilingual Human Resources Professional, you need a solid grasp of HR practices, employment law, and fluency in at least two languages, typically supported by a bachelor's degree in HR or a related field. Familiarity with HRIS systems, payroll software, and certifications like SHRM-CP or PHR are highly valuable. Strong interpersonal communication, cultural sensitivity, and problem-solving skills distinguish top performers in this role. These qualifications enable effective support of diverse workforces, ensure compliance, and foster inclusive organizational cultures.

How does being bilingual enhance collaboration and communication within an HR team?

Being bilingual as a Human Resources professional allows you to bridge language gaps between employees and management, ensuring that all staff feel heard and understood. This skill is especially valuable in diverse workplaces where employees may have varying levels of English proficiency. Bilingual HR professionals often facilitate smoother onboarding, mediate conflicts more effectively, and help translate key policies or documents. This not only improves team cohesion but also supports a more inclusive organizational culture.

What does a Bilingual Human Resources Professional do?

A Bilingual Human Resources Professional manages HR functions such as recruiting, employee relations, and compliance while using fluency in two or more languages to communicate effectively with a diverse workforce. They often serve as a bridge between employees and management, ensuring that policies and procedures are understood and followed by all staff members, regardless of language barriers. Their language skills help organizations build inclusive workplaces and support multicultural teams.

Bilingual HR Generalist / Human Resources Specialist
Spanish/English | Direct Hire | Piscataway, NJ

United Staffing Solutions is representing a growing packaging manufacturer and retailer in their search for an experienced HR professional to join their team immediately. This is a direct hire opportunity within a small, fast-paced HR department that requires someone who can work independently with minimal training.

The ideal candidate will have at least 2 years of hands-on HR and NJ payroll experience, strong knowledge of New Jersey labor laws, and the ability to manage multiple HR functions with professionalism, empathy, and attention to detail.

Schedule: Mondayโ€“Friday 8AMโ€“5PM

Salary: $58,000 โ€“ $65,000 annually depending on experience

Location: Fully onsite in Piscataway, NJ
Hiring: Immediate direct hire/permanent opportunity

Responsibilities for the HR Generalist:

  • Processing payroll for approximately 124 hourly employees and 33 salaried employees
  • Handling child support orders, garnishments, and payroll-related deductions
  • Managing workersโ€™ compensation claims and incident reports
  • Supporting employee relations matters with professionalism and discretion
  • Preparing verification of employment letters and employment documentation
  • Maintaining organized employee files and HR records through SharePoint
  • Running employee and payroll-related reports
  • Handling OSHA form filings and liaising during OSHA investigations
  • Communicating with the Department of Labor and providing requested reports
  • Recruiting through Indeed, walk-ins, and employee referrals
  • Screening, interviewing, onboarding, and offboarding employees
  • Supporting HR compliance and day-to-day HR operations
  • Managing HR processes for both onsite and remote employees

Requirements for the HR Generalist:

  • Minimum 2 years of HR and payroll experience required
  • Experience processing New Jersey payroll is REQUIRED
  • Strong understanding of NJ labor laws and compliance requirements
  • Experience handling HR functions with limited supervision
  • Bilingual Spanish/English REQUIRED
  • Experience with Excelforce HR/payroll software preferred
  • Experience using SharePoint for employee file management preferred
  • Strong organizational, time management, and multitasking skills
  • High attention to detail and accuracy
  • Professional, respectful, empathetic, and dependable demeanor
  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ment
